Решение позволяет организовать учет на непокрытом сетью материальном складе при помощи планшета, сканера штрихкодов и 1С УПП
Итак дано: Планшет с Windows/Linux, сканер штрихкодов, большой склад (территориально), НЕпокрытый WiFi. Необходимо организовать заполнение документов (Инвентаризация, Оприходование, Реализация, Перемещение) в 1С при помощи сканера штрихкодов.
Устанавливать на планшет 1С с независимой базой и потом синхронизировать две базы (сетевую и локальную) желание отпало сразу. Потому было решено написать программу для планшетника, которая будет работать со сканером и выгружать полученные данные в XML-файл, и обработку в 1С, которая будет: во-первых, выгружать базу штрихкодов в файл, а во-вторых, из другого файла загружать в документы данные, полученные с планшетника.
Вот результат работы:
- Программа для планшетника. Написана на Lazarus. Откомпилирована под Windows. При незначительной модификации (а возможно и вовсе без неё) будет работать и под Linux. Необходимо наличие установленной базы MySQL. Исходники программы скачать можно здесь: https://sourceforge.net/projects/scanpcme/files/ . ПО обеспечивает загрузку базы штрихкодов из XML-файла, и выгрузку в другой XML-файл результатов работы.
- Внешняя обработка 1С. Тестировалась в УПП 1.3 платформа 8.2. Вероятно, будет работать и в конфигурации УТ (не проверено). Позволяет выгружать в XML-файл штрихкоды, а также загружать из XML результаты работы на планшетнике в документы «Реализация товаров и услуг», «Оприходование товаров», «Требование-накладная», «Поступление товаров и услуг».
Расположение файлов загрузки/выгрузки жестко задано в коде (нужно поправить 1 раз руками).
Файлы обработки:
- 2_Kompleksnoe_reshenie_dlya_raboty_so_skanerom_na_materialnom_sklade.zip Для скачивания нужна регистрация
- 1_Kompleksnoe_reshenie_dlya_raboty_so_skanerom_na_materialnom_sklade.epf Для скачивания нужна регистрация
-
В этой группе 1С
- Реестр документов для Комплексной (8.2) (аналог реестра в УТ 10.3)
- Переброска данных из Альфа-Авто 7.7 (Автосалон-Автосервис-Автозапчасти) в Бухгалтерию 2.0 (для платформы 8.2)
- Обработка формирования актов взаиморасчетов
- Распределение уплаты НДФЛ по людям
- Заполнение документа "Счет на оплату" по документу "Оказание услуг". Внешняя обработка для 1С бухгалтерия 8, ред. 2.0
- Уменьшение длины кода справочников и документов в 1С 7.7
- Перечисление НДФЛ в разрезе КОСГУ
- ЗУП: Справки 2НДФЛ. Как сделать НДФЛ перечисленный и удержанный = НДФЛ исчисленному. Для релиза 46.1 и старше.